Math

  • Number Sense
  • Operations
  • Fractions/decimals/percents
  • Data and Statistics
  • Patterns and Algebra
  • Geometry
  • Measurement

  • I hold high expectations and appropriately challenge and support every student to meet his or her greatest potential.
  • Understanding of mathematical concepts deepens over time as students have the opportunity to repeatedly engage with topics and apply what they understand across a variety of contexts and levels.
  • Mathematical understanding builds upon itself. Skipping topics leads to challenges later that can impede success and weaken confidence.
  • A student’s interest in math is critical for overall success in the topic; learning math should be enjoyable.

Grading

  • Personal achievement over scale
  • All work will be commented on or conferenced about, not all work will be graded
  • 1-4 scale on report card
  • 3 is expected, reach for 4
  • Percentages sometimes used for math or science
